**Ticket: Password reset revamp — support heads-up**

The new Keyfern reset flow ships this week. Users now get a six-digit code instead of a link, and codes expire in ten minutes. Expect a bump in "code expired" tickets — just have users request a fresh one. Old links stop working Friday. For escalations, reference the rollout build token listed below.

pipeline stamp: htk9_ce63042d9

**Runbook: Account Recovery — Lintbase Baseline**

If the Quillmark static-analysis baseline file gets clobbered during a release cut, don't panic. Regenerate it from the last tagged build on Ferrowick CI, then diff against main to confirm only suppressions changed. If the recovery account for the baseline vault is locked (happens more than we'd like), you'll need to re-authenticate as the release role. Use the passphrase below to unlock the release role:

unlock words, hahip-baduf: holwyn-istath-julvan

**Ticket: DeployBot replies with stale status after rollback**

So our friendly DeployBot in the Harborline chat keeps reporting the *previous* deploy as "live" for up to ten minutes after a rollback. Root cause looks like the status cache in the Mossgate worker never invalidates on rollback events — it only listens for forward deploys. Future maintainers: the fix is probably a second subscription on the rollback topic, but watch out for the dedupe logic. The build where we first reproduced this is the one below.

build token for fajof-yahof: htk4_869f

## Deployment

The Prosceniq seat-map renderer for the Gildenhall Theatre ships as a stateless container behind the venue's edge proxy. It holds no patron data; seat availability is fetched per-request from the Boxline inventory service and cached for at most ten seconds. TLS terminates at the proxy, and the renderer validates signed availability payloads before drawing anything. Deploys are immutable and rollbacks are tag-based. The renderer reads its runtime configuration from the values below.

settings of tagef-bawif:
DRUIX_HOST=druix.zemvarlabs.internal
DRUIX_PORT=8000